The Birth of a Legend

The Adidas Predator was born out of a desire to create a boot that could enhance a player's control and precision. The brainchild of ex-Australian footballer Craig Johnston, the Predator was designed with rubber fins on the upper to increase spin and control on the ball. The first model, the Adidas Predator, revolutionized the football boot industry and set a new standard for performance footwear.

Iconic Players and Moments

The Adidas Predator has been worn by some of the most iconic players in football history. Legends like Zinedine Zidane, David Beckham, and Steven Gerrard have all donned the Predator, contributing to its status as a boot of choice for elite players. These players have had unforgettable moments on the pitch while wearing the Predator, further cementing its legacy in the sport.
